Nintendo Direct showcase of 2022.Last night Nintendo unveiled some huge announcements of new games, including Fire Emblem, Mario Strikers, Chrono Cross, Xenoblade Chronicles 3, and even the release of the blockbuster No Man's Sky for its portable console.Fans have gone wild for the announcement of Nintendo Switch Sports, a sequel to the blockbuster Wii Sports series which sees players use motion controllers to play virtual bowling, tennis, soccer, badminton and more.

Perhaps the biggest news though is that Mario Kart 8 Deluxe is set to get a whopping 48 new racecourses added throughout the year.The Mario Kart 8 Deluxe 'Booster Course Pass' will be available for free to Nintendo Switch Online Expansion members, or can be bought separately for £22.49 on the eStore.

The courses, which will be a mixture of new racetracks and old classics, will be released in sets of eight over the year, with the first 'wave' released on 18th March 2022.
